The Genesis of the Ban: Understanding the Initial Policy Announcement
The initial announcement of the transgender military ban came via a series of tweets by President Trump in July 2017. The stated rationale, often cited by administration officials, focused on concerns about military readiness and the perceived costs associated with transgender healthcare. The administration argued that the presence of transgender individuals would disrupt unit cohesion, create undue medical burdens, and negatively impact operational effectiveness. This assertion, however, lacked substantial evidence and was widely criticized by medical professionals and military experts.
- Key statements made by President Trump and relevant officials: The announcements lacked detailed justification, relying heavily on unsubstantiated claims about potential disruptions and costs. Official statements frequently cited concerns about "burden" and "disruption" without providing quantifiable data.
- Referenced concerns about military readiness and cost: The administration repeatedly emphasized the financial burden of providing healthcare for transgender service members, including hormone therapy and gender-affirming surgeries. These concerns were often exaggerated and failed to account for the relatively small number of transgender service members compared to the overall size of the military.
- Initial public reaction and political fallout: The announcement ignited widespread protests and condemnation from human rights organizations, LGBTQ+ advocacy groups, and many Democratic politicians. The ban was immediately challenged in court, setting the stage for years of legal battles.
Legal Challenges and Court Battles: The Fight for Inclusion
The Trump administration's transgender military ban faced numerous lawsuits almost immediately. The American Civil Liberties Union (ACLU) and other organizations spearheaded legal challenges, arguing that the ban violated the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ment and discriminated against transgender individuals based on their gender identity.
- Key arguments made by plaintiffs: Plaintiffs argued that the ban lacked a rational basis, was based on unfounded assumptions about military readiness, and inflicted significant harm on transgender service members. They presented evidence refuting the administration’s claims regarding costs and operational disruptions.
- Significant court rulings and their impact: Lower courts largely sided with the plaintiffs, issuing injunctions blocking the enforcement of the ban. While the Supreme Court declined to directly rule on the constitutionality of the ban in the initial cases, these lower-court victories effectively prevented its full implementation.
- Mention key organizations and individuals involved in the litigation: The ACLU, Lambda Legal, and numerous individual transgender service members played crucial roles in the litigation. The cases involved complex legal arguments concerning discrimination, equal protection, and the rights of transgender individuals in the military.
The Impact on Transgender Service Members: Personal Stories and Statistics
The transgender military ban inflicted significant emotional and professional harm on affected service members. The uncertainty surrounding their future careers, coupled with the stigma associated with the ban, caused many to experience stress, anxiety, and depression. Many were forced to leave the military, losing their careers and benefits.
- Statistics on the number of transgender service members affected: While precise figures are difficult to obtain, estimates suggest thousands of transgender service members were directly impacted by the ban.
- Anecdotal evidence (focus on factual accounts, avoiding biased opinions): Numerous accounts detail the challenges faced by transgender service members who were forced to choose between their identity and their military careers. These stories highlight the human cost of discriminatory policies.
- Impact on morale and recruitment within the military: The ban negatively impacted the morale and recruitment efforts of the military. It sent a message that the military was not an inclusive environment for LGBTQ+ individuals, discouraging potential recruits and harming the military's ability to attract and retain talented personnel.
The Biden Administration's Reversal: A New Era for Transgender Inclusion in the Military?
Upon taking office, the Biden administration swiftly reversed the Trump-era transgender military ban. President Biden issued an executive order in January 2021 ending the discriminatory policy and allowing transgender individuals to serve openly in the military.
- The official announcement and its reasoning: The Biden administration stated that the ban was discriminatory and inconsistent with the values of equality and inclusion. The reversal aimed to restore dignity and opportunity for transgender service members.
- Steps taken to implement the reversal: The Department of Defense implemented policies to ensure transgender individuals could enlist and continue their service without facing discrimination. This included restoring healthcare benefits and addressing any past injustices.
- Ongoing challenges and the current state of transgender inclusion in the military: While the ban's reversal was a significant step forward, challenges remain. Some transgender service members still face discrimination, and ongoing efforts are needed to ensure full and equal inclusion within the military.
